The S&P utilities stock subsector is down about 13% this year, they ...You pay no tax. This is a huge benefit for utility stock dividend investors that otherwise have low incomes. Furthermore, for those that pay income tax rates greater than 12% and up to 35%, utility stock dividends are taxed at a 15% rate. Finally, the tax rate on qualified utility stock dividends is capped at 20%.

Today, crude prices plunged more than 4 ...Aug 22, 2023 · Utilities are less attractive when "risk-free" investments, like money market mutual funds or Treasury bills, are paying some of the highest returns in decades. After all, why would you own utilities stocks — the sector is expected to pay a dividend yield of 3.5% this year — when you could own a six-month Treasury bill that's basically risk ... 3.20. Firstly, people are less likely to switch to a new utility provider during a recession, as they are worried about their financial stability. Secondly, utility providers often have regulated prices, which means that they cannot raise prices as much as other companies can.
